Sir, – I was amused by the comparisons made by both contributors in “Are holidays in Ireland still ‘a rip-off’? Georgina Campbell and Conor Pope debate the issue” (Opinion & Analysis, May 21st). Conor complains, rightly in my opinion, about paying €3.60 for a coffee, while Georgina lauds coffee and a biscuit for €5.50.
That must have been some biscuit for €1.90. – Yours, etc,
